Transport to and around Rowardennan

The nearest airport is in Glasgow International Airport (GLA), located 21.9 mi (35.3 km) from the city centre. If you're unable to find a flight that fits your schedule, you might consider flying into Glasgow (PIK-Prestwick), which is 45 mi (72.4 km) away.

What are the top attractions in Rowardennan?
In Rowardennan, visitors are drawn to the stunning natural beauty of Loch Lomond, which offers opportunities for boating, fishing, and scenic walks along the waterfront. The West Highland Way, a renowned long-distance hiking trail, passes through Rowardennan, allowing outdoor enthusiasts to explore breathtaking landscapes and enjoy the tranquillity of the Scottish Highlands.The nearby Rowardennan Hotel is a popular spot for refreshments and offers picturesque views of the loch. Additionally, the area is ideal for wildlife spotting, with opportunities to see various bird species and even deer in the surrounding woodlands. For those interested in history, the ruins of the old church and the nearby Rob Roy's Cave provide a glimpse into the region's rich heritage.
